Furoshiki is a traditional Japanese wrapping cloth which can be used time and time again and in a multitude of different applications.
One of the primary uses for a furoshiki is as an easy zero-waste way to wrap gifts.
Furoshiki can be used in a variety of different ways other than as gift wrapping, as a scarf, belt or bandana, hanky, tablecloth, napkin, pocket square, as a makeup bag or handbag.
